 Rosatom Discussing Nuclear Projects With Niger & Ethiopia "Rosatom is open to discussing possible forms of cooperation and is prepared to offer modern, reliable, and safe technologies," the Russian state corporation stated, Sputnik reported. Cooperation between the parties is currently focused on establishing working mechanisms and defining project parameters, with decisions being taken gradually in line with the host country’s priorities and international safety standards, Rosatom said. Rosatom is in dialogue with more than 20 African countries on such areas as the construction of large and small nuclear power plants, nuclear science and technology centers, and the development of uranium deposits.

Gospel singer Big Bolaji buried in Ibadan


Popular Nigerian gospel artiste, Bolaji Olanrewaju, popularly known as Big Bolaji, has been laid to rest in Ibadan, Oyo State, following his death on April 19 after a brief illness.

He was 50 years old.

The final rites began on Wednesday with a funeral service and lying-in-state held at the Hall of Grace, Jogor Centre, Ibadan.

The solemn event drew family members, close friends, and a host of fellow gospel singers who came to pay their last respects.

Among those in attendance were notable figures in the gospel music community, including Tosin Bee, Mike Abdul, Bidemi Olaoba, Yetunde Are, and popular comedian, Woli Agba.

Emotional moments captured on social media showed pallbearers carrying Bolaji’s flower-decked casket into the venue, as mourners gathered in silence.

A moving tribute video chronicling his musical journey and spiritual impact was played during the service, drawing tears and applause from attendees.

Following the service, the burial procession proceeded to All Souls Private Cemetery in Ido, Ibadan, where Big Bolaji was laid to rest.

His wife, siblings, and loved ones stood in quiet reflection as the singer was committed to the earth.
